2 Timothy 2:2-4
Wycliffe Bible
2 And what things thou hast heard of me by many witnesses, betake thou these to faithful men, which shall be able also to teach other men.
3 Travail thou as a good knight of Christ Jesus. [Travail thou as a good knight of Jesus Christ.]
4 No man holding knighthood to God, wrappeth himself [enwrappeth himself] with worldly needs, that he please to him, to whom he hath proved himself.

2 Timothy 2:2-4
New International Version
2 And the things you have heard me say(A) in the presence of many witnesses(B) entrust to reliable people who will also be qualified to teach others. 3 Join with me in suffering,(C) like a good soldier(D) of Christ Jesus. 4 No one serving as a soldier gets entangled in civilian affairs, but rather tries to please his commanding officer.
